Transaction 31ba68f2d91d9398bd489ed14c3c15166f29bbedf0267a38b8ea5cc7aaa21241

1 Input
2 Outputs
  • 31ba68f2d91d9398bd489ed14c3c15166f29bbedf0267a38b8ea5cc7aaa21241:0
  • value  1062687551
    address  1FMZcTBkYxYGXHS9k8nVRwntwTtZ4bVAdZ
  • 31ba68f2d91d9398bd489ed14c3c15166f29bbedf0267a38b8ea5cc7aaa21241:1
  • value  10000000
    address  16tGuSQybKCxmgf8n9JJdZoi4K5NnQEqmN